The innovation district at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park
The 2012 Olympic Games left a legacy in Stratford: an Innovation District. And IQL is a proud part of that. At IQL we’ve welcomed mammoth organisations who have moved their Headquarters into our buildings. Transport for London, the Financial Conduct Authority, the British Council and UNICEF are all reaping the benefits of ergonomically designed workplaces. The neighbouring East Bank development will see BBC Music, Sadler’s Wells, V&A, UCL and UAL open campuses next to the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park, while Westfield and London Stadium already offer ample leisure opportunities for residents, employees and visitors.
These well-established names are already partnering with Here East – a hub of innovation with a clear community conscience. Here start-ups and local businesses work together in a collaborative environment. The aim is to succeed, but also to increase opportunity for training and employment within the local community. Here East will soon be home to separate research facilities for the V&A as well as providing research space for some of the UK’s leading universities.

What does this mean for Stratford?
As a result of the above, Stratford will welcome a further 6.5 million visitors a year, once East Bank is open. By the mid-2020s, 40,000 new jobs will have come to the area, as well as apprenticeships in both the creative and construction industries. Upon the opening of University College London and the London College of Fashion, around 10,000 students will regularly be travelling to Stratford as part of their education.
